World Poker Tour betting on coast

BILOXI The World Poker Tour will bring its televised high-limits poker tournament to the Beau Rivage in Biloxi on Aug. 29 to Sept. 9. The event, the first televised poker tournament on the Mississippi Gulf Coast, is one of 19 stops in Season VI of the World Poker Tournament.

Casino poker language:

  • LATE POSITION - For a particular betting round, a player who does not have to act until most of the other players have acted.
  • BLACK - When referring to chips, black usually stands for $100 casino chips. "This guy sits down with a stack of blacks and raises the first bet." Not ALL casinos use black for $100 but that is the common usage.
  • UNDER THE GUN - The position that has to act first in a round of betting.
  • GUT SHOT - A draw to an inside straight, as in 2-3-4-6.
  • POSSIBLE [STRAIGHT/FLUSH] - Up cards that quite possibly could lead to a straight and/or a flush.
  • SPLIT [THE POT] - To split the pot between two or more players. Related term: QUARTER.
